summaryrefslogtreecommitdiff
path: root/news/nntp/files/patch-server-misc.c
diff options
context:
space:
mode:
authorDirk Meyer <dinoex@FreeBSD.org>2002-11-04 05:00:14 +0000
committerDirk Meyer <dinoex@FreeBSD.org>2002-11-04 05:00:14 +0000
commit3ff37e385bb15e608586b24278ba3dde9ea57151 (patch)
tree0b09981cfb671da75e612993d4ac3a3ef4a2551b /news/nntp/files/patch-server-misc.c
parent- Fix perl/reinplace problems (diff)
- reorder patches
- use DIRENT - honor CFLAGS - fix missing includes
Notes
Notes: svn path=/head/; revision=69435
Diffstat (limited to 'news/nntp/files/patch-server-misc.c')
-rw-r--r--news/nntp/files/patch-server-misc.c36
1 files changed, 36 insertions, 0 deletions
diff --git a/news/nntp/files/patch-server-misc.c b/news/nntp/files/patch-server-misc.c
new file mode 100644
index 000000000000..68210ecbd9e5
--- /dev/null
+++ b/news/nntp/files/patch-server-misc.c
@@ -0,0 +1,36 @@
+--- server/misc.c.orig Tue Jan 9 08:28:04 1996
++++ server/misc.c Fri Jan 25 06:16:44 2002
+@@ -965,6 +965,27 @@
+ ** none.
+ */
+
++
++#if defined(BSD_44)
++#include <stdlib.h>
++
++int
++getla( void )
++{
++ double avenrun[3];
++ int rc;
++
++ rc = getloadavg( avenrun, 1 );
++ if ( rc == -1 )
++ return 1;
++# ifdef FSCALE
++ return ((int) (avenrun[0] + FSCALE/2) >> FSHIFT);
++# else
++ return ((int) (avenrun[0] + 0.5));
++# endif
++}
++
++#else
+ #if defined(USG) && !defined(SVR4)
+ int
+ getla()
+@@ -1058,4 +1079,5 @@
+ # endif
+ }
+ #endif
++#endif /* BSD_44 */
+ #endif /* LOAD */